- Details
- Timeline
- Similar Titles
1581-1641
Italianartist
Saint George
134.3 x 98 cms | 52 3/4 x 38 1/2 ins
Oil on canvas
Barnard Castle| United Kingdom
1581-1641
Italianartist
Saint George
134.3 x 98 cms | 52 3/4 x 38 1/2 ins
Oil on canvas
Barnard Castle| United Kingdom